Patent number: 8381862Abstract: A pedal arrangement for a motor vehicle includes a pedal arm connected to the vehicle structure via a first pivotal joint connection and connected to a force transmitting element via a second pivotal joint connection. The pedal arrangement further includes a pyrotechnically driven release arrangement. The release arrangement is adapted to perform a release movement in order to release the second pivotal joint connection upon being driven in response to a corresponding activation signal. The release movement of the release arrangement is based on a translational movement essentially along the pedal arm.Type: GrantFiled: December 16, 2010Date of Patent: February 26, 2013Assignee: Autoliv Development ABInventors: Erik Hjerpe, Christian Forsberg

Publication number: 20130036934Abstract: A gas generator has two pyrotechnic charges in two chambers having openings for gas outlet to the outside. Only the first chamber is provided with an igniter for first charge. The chambers are separated by a third wall with a through hole for permanent gas communication, sealed in an initial state by a cap. The cap is configured to be broken under the pressure of the combustion gases from first charge to keep the hole opened permanently and allow the combustion gases from the first charge to go via the hole kept permanently opened from a first chamber to a second chamber, where these gases induce the combustion of charge.Type: ApplicationFiled: April 15, 2011Publication date: February 14, 2013Applicant: AUTOLIV DEVELOPMENT ABInventors: Gérald Prima, Sébastien Kermarrec, Maxime Lejeune, Gildas Clech

Patent number: 8370027Abstract: A vehicle safety system is provided that includes an alcohol concentration determining arrangement. A control unit is adapted to receive and analyze data from the alcohol concentration determining arrangement and output a blocking signal or a dissuasion signal under certain conditions. A blocking arrangement is adapted to prevent driving of the vehicle by the vehicle occupant upon receipt of a blocking signal. An output device is adapted to receive the dissuasion signal and to present a warning to the vehicle occupant to dissuade the occupant from driving the vehicle. The control unit is operable to categorize the concentration of alcohol in the occupant's blood into one of three categories: a low concentration category, in which the blocking signal will not be generated, a high concentration category, in which the blocking signal will be generated, and an intermediate category, in which the dissuasion signal will be generated.Type: GrantFiled: November 23, 2007Date of Patent: February 5, 2013Assignee: Autoliv Development ABInventors: Hakan Pettersson, Bertil Hok

Publication number: 20130022851Abstract: A safety arrangement in a motor vehicle having a battery is designed to protect the battery from damage in the event that the vehicle is involved in an accident. The safety arrangement is particularly suitable for electric vehicles or so-called hybrid motor vehicles. The arrangement incorporates an inflatable unit having a substantially rigid wall member and a flexible layer of sheet material secured to one another to define an inflatable chamber between the wall member and the flexible layer. The wall member is mounted in spaced relation to the battery. The flexible layer is interposed between the wall member and the battery, such that inflation of the chamber, for example by a gas generator or the like, is effective to urge the flexible layer towards the battery.Type: ApplicationFiled: October 15, 2010Publication date: January 24, 2013Applicant: AUTOLIV DEVELOPMENT ABInventor: Nelson De Oliveira

Patent number: 8348307Abstract: A seatbelt device having a first energy absorbing member with two axial direction end portions attached respectively to a spindle and a lock member and which absorbs energy by undergoing twisting deformation when a load of at least a predetermined value acts on the spindle while the lock member is locked during an emergency. A second energy absorbing member is fixed to the spindle at one end portion and extends through a bend route provided in the lock member. The second energy absorbing member absorbs energy by being pulled through the bend route so as to undergo plastic deformation when the spindle rotates as a result of twisting of the first energy absorbing member. A deformation portion is interposed between a turned back portion of the second energy absorbing member and the spindle.Type: GrantFiled: December 3, 2009Date of Patent: January 8, 2013Assignee: Autoliv Development ABInventor: Kazuhiro Moro

Patent number: 8346463Abstract: In at least one embodiment of the present invention a driving aid system for mounting in a road vehicle is provided. The driving aid system comprises a detection system for detecting and storing profiles of characteristics of objects around the vehicle along a road on which the vehicle is being driven. A positioning system is for providing a current position of the vehicle. Profiles of characteristics of objects are stored in relation to the detected position of the vehicle. A processing arrangement compares currently detected profiles with earlier stored profiles and, if a match between a currently detected profile and an earlier stored profile is found, then the current position of the vehicle is determined relative to an object corresponding to the earlier stored profile, and the same or other earlier stored profiles is used to predict the future surroundings of the vehicle.Type: GrantFiled: March 9, 2007Date of Patent: January 1, 2013Assignee: Autoliv Development ABInventors: Jonas Bärgman, Jan-Erik Källhammer
